From whitin an aggregate sfunc I did: oldcontext = MemoryContextSwitchTo(fcinfo->flinfo->fn_mcxt); geom = (GEOMETRY*)PG_DETOAST_DATUM(datum); MemoryContextSwitchTo(oldcontext); And later in aggregate's finalfunc:pfree(geom); Result:segfault! What's wrong with it ? NOTE that if I MemoryContextAllocate in fcinfo->flinfo->fn_mcxt and memcopy DETOASTED geom, everything works (ar at least it seems to) --strk; strk wrote: > Tom, thanks again for the quick answer and > sorry for the lame question about memor allocation. > > I hope this is acceptable: > Is there a way to make PG_DETOAST_DATUM and friends allocate > memory in a custom memory context ? > > Right now I'm DETOASTing, memcopying in a custom context > and pfreeing the DETOASTed datum, I'd like to avoid one > copy. > > TIA. > --strk; > > ---------------------------(end of broadcast)--------------------------- > TIP 9: the planner will ignore your desire to choose an index scan if your > joining column's datatypes do not match
